This performance is the result of the work of guitarist Dave Miller. Dave was finishing up at Northern Illinois University at the time and was working on a project about the music of Lennie Tristano and his cohorts – Warne Marsh, Lee Konitz and others. He put a ton of work into this, so he gets all the credit for this performance. Greg Ward & Geof Bradfield had a tough job as well. They had to learn and nail those melodies! Hyosub Kim and I pretty much just enjoyed the ride (by the way, I miss playing with Hyosub!). Listening back I’m very proud of the playing on this recording. Also, I think we came up with some nice arrangements of Tristano’s music, which is not easy to do. I remember having fun coming up with our version of “Turkish Mambo” on my laptop.
